If your idea of an epic winter day is gliding over an outdoor rink, you’re not alone. There’s something inherently romantic about ice skating. Perhaps it is the combination of wintery atmosphere, sparkling lights, and potentially grabbing onto someone as you try not to fall, that is hard to beat.
Whether you want to share a magical experience with a partner or just want the family to exercise, here's a guide to public outdoor ice skating locations.



These destinations promise an experience that will warm your heart even in the chilliest of temperatures. So, pack your skates, bundle up and get ready to be enriched by winter.
Outdoor rinks need cold average daily temperatures, ideally below –10°C, to be open. Please check conditions before heading out.

Safety tips
- Wear a helmet. In some locations, participants of all ages are required to wear a CSA-approved helmet while on ice.
- Skating is always at your own risk.
